Questões sobre SQL

Pesquise questões de concurso nos filtros abaixo

Listagem de Questões sobre SQL

#Questão 971595 - Banco de Dados, SQL, FGV, 2022, TJ-DFT, Analista Judiciário - Análise de Sistemas

Tabela TURFE

Considere um banco de dados relacional que contém uma única tabela, TURFE, cuja estrutura é exibida com sua instância a seguir.



Para cada páreo, ou corrida, são armazenados os nomes dos cavalos participantes e os respectivos tempos. A classificação de cada cavalo numa corrida segue a ordem crescente de tempo. Não há empates.


Com relação à tabela TURFE, descrita anteriormente, o comando SQL que exibe, para cada páreo, somente o cavalo vencedor com o respectivo tempo é:

#Questão 971609 - Banco de Dados, SQL, FGV, 2022, MPE-SC, Analista em Tecnologia da Informação

Analise os comandos SQL abaixo, supondo que T é uma tabela que contém as colunas A, B e C.

I. select A, B from T order by C II. select A, B, C from T order by 2 III. select A, B from T order by max(C) IV. select A, B, C from T order by B+C

São aceitos no SQL Server, no MySQL e no Oracle somente os comandos:

#Questão 971610 - Banco de Dados, SQL, FGV, 2022, MPE-SC, Analista em Tecnologia da Informação

Maria trabalha com um banco de dados onde há uma tabela T com linhas repetidas. Ela precisa remover as repetições indesejadas, porém mantendo as linhas sem repetição e apenas uma linha de cada conjunto de linhas repetidas, como mostrado a seguir. 
Instância da tabela T antes da remoção:
Imagem associada para resolução da questão
Instância da tabela T após a remoção:
Imagem associada para resolução da questão

Maria optou por usar o comando abaixo para realizar a tarefa.
delete from T where exists (select * FROM T t1            where T.A = t1.A and T.B = t1.B                 and T.C = t1.C)

Na execução desse comando, serão removidas: 

#Questão 971613 - Banco de Dados, SQL, FGV, 2022, MPE-SC, Analista em Tecnologia da Informação

João trabalha na migração para o MySQL de um sistema baseado originalmente no SQL Server.
Nesse contexto, nos comandos SQL que eventualmente utilizem o operador like, João:

#Questão 971615 - Banco de Dados, SQL, FGV, 2022, MPE-SC, Analista em Tecnologia da Informação

Considere uma tabela relacional T com três colunas, A, B e C. Para as colunas A e B, separadamente, foram criados índices do tipo bitmap, cujos conteúdos são exibidos a seguir, na ordem.
Imagem associada para resolução da questão
Nesse contexto, o valor exibido pela execução do comando SQL
select sum(1) contagem from T where A=1010 or B=316

deve ser:

Navegue em mais matérias e assuntos

{TITLE}

{CONTENT}

{TITLE}

{CONTENT}
Estude Grátis